The GRE Verbal and Quantitative Reasoning sections are each scored from 130 to 170, and the Analytical Writing section is scored from 0 to 6. Use our free GRE Score Calculator to estimate your score, and our percentile calculator to see where you rank among all test takers.
GRE scores are valid for five years from your test date. See our GRE Score Expiration guide for how the 5-year validity period affects your graduate school applications.
